    About a year ago we had a basement sump backup for which we called ServiceMaster Advantage of…read moreLafayette. The minor disaster required the carpet of the built-in basement be replaced. Separate crews were assigned to take out the damaged materials. ServiceMaster sent Eddie Diaz to scope the work and explain what would be done. The crew he sent about a week later, to pull out the damaged carpet, asked for entry and spent a good amount of time on the work. But it seems to be much more than assigned work that occupied their time. When they were done they departed quickly and without checking in to show me what they had done. Within a few weeks of their work, I noticed assorted items of thousands of dollars of value--ammunition, vinyl record albums from the 1960s-70s, military uniform items and insignia, CDs, electronics, and other personal property--missing from my office and the nearby closet, neither of which had any damage. I had happened to inventory many items a few weeks before their work and knew well what I had from inventory and electronic receipts, that the items were definitely gone, and that no other people had any access to the areas whence the items disappeared. I compiled a list of what I realized was missing and filed a statement with the Tippecanoe County Sheriff's office a few weeks later, after checking carefully what was missing. The detective investigated the slickie boys whose names they got from ServiceMaster, but the identified boys claimed they were never at my house, and I had no solid proof they were. In the intervening months a few other items are also missing, having not been noticed among the many items in the office area until recently needed. With highly restricted access to the area, those had to disappear the same time as the other property--no other explanation makes sense. Some lessons: Even if very busy on other activities, observe the laborers closely, frequently, randomly, and fully trust none requiring entry to your premises--especially not any low-skill, part-timers who might be unable to gain more reliable employment. So they cannot lie that they never worked at your location, photograph their government issued facial ID and their vehicle--including the license plate--before allowing them entry. Unless it is untrustworthy, any competent business will be certain to have the supervisor come by that day, when the work is done, to ensure it has been performed suitably and honestly. Other contractors do so. For the money paid, the customer has every right to expect the supervisor sending the laborers to be professional and "close the loop." We have installed a security system in the meantime. The multiple cameras would have captured the boys carrying out their stolen property. I will not call upon this business again.
